1. Choosing the Wrong Tent Size
Mistake: Thinking a “2-person tent” comfortably fits two adults plus gear. Spoiler: It doesn’t. Most tents are a tight squeeze, leaving no room for backpacks or midnight snack raids.

2. Ignoring Weather Ratings
Mistake: Assuming all tents work in all seasons. A summer tent won’t protect you from wind or rain, and a 4-season tent might roast you in July.

4. Poor Campsite Selection
Mistake: Plopping your tent on a slope (hello, midnight slide) or under a dead tree branch.

5. Forgetting to Waterproof
Mistake: Trusting factory waterproofing. Seams leak, and rainflies sag if not sealed properly.

10. Post-Trip Neglect
Mistake: Stuffing a damp tent into your trunk. Mold city.
